Unhappy Rear suspension problem

I took my car in to my dealer2 weeks ago to install the insulator sleeves to eliminate the clunk noise in the Rear, after several days they call me that my car was ready, short after driving out the dealer I felt the same noise. I took the car back several days later and today after 3 days they haven't figure out a where the noice it's coming from or how to fix it.
If any of you are having this issue, I love to hear about it.

My dealer call me early this morning that my car was ready, when I asked what they did, they said that Jaguar asked them to re-due the sleeves and to re-torque everything again.
I drove it home and everything seems ok, I did not hear any clunk so I think this time they got it fix. Finally I can enjoy my F-Type.

Got the same problem. 500miles on clock. Knocking/clunking from rear when going over very gentle undulating roads/ slight bumps. Took in to dealer. Agreed a problem so put on ramps and suspected anti roll bar bushes. Took in today for reapir.. It's not. Need a dictat/memo/instruction from head office before they can repair. But none on system so they can't and are returning car unmended and I have to wait until Head Office have figured out what the issue is... without the car?
